How Multi-Factor Authentication Reinforces Player Verification Processes
Multi-Factor Authentication (MFA) is a cornerstone of modern online security, significantly reducing the risk of unauthorized account access. At Luckypays Casino, MFA requires players to verify their identity through two or more independent methods, such as a password combined with a one-time code sent via SMS or email. This layered approach enhances security by making it 99.9% harder for hackers to compromise accounts, even if login credentials are stolen.
For example, during account creation, players are prompted to enable MFA, which activates additional verification steps for login attempts. This not only prevents unauthorized access but also aligns with industry standards, as 95% of regulated online casinos now implement MFA to safeguard player data. Real-world cases demonstrate that casinos employing MFA experience a 50% reduction in account breaches, emphasizing its effectiveness.
Furthermore, MFA plays a crucial role in verifying players during sensitive transactions, such as withdrawals exceeding $500 or account updates, ensuring that only authorized individuals can approve these actions. By integrating MFA seamlessly into its platform, Luckypays guarantees that player verification processes are both robust and user-friendly.
Leveraging Real-Time Transaction Monitoring to Detect Suspicious Behavior
Real-time transaction monitoring is vital for preventing fraud and maintaining the integrity of online gambling platforms. Luckypays Casino employs advanced algorithms that analyze transactions instantly, flagging any suspicious activities based on patterns such as unusual bet sizes, rapid deposit-withdrawal cycles, or deviations from typical player behavior.
For instance, if a player suddenly initiates a series of transactions totaling over $10,000 within a short timeframe, the system automatically triggers an alert for manual review. This proactive approach allows the casino to intervene swiftly, potentially halting fraudulent activities before they result in financial loss or data compromise.
Industry data indicates that real-time monitoring reduces fraudulent transactions by up to 70%, significantly enhancing overall security. Additionally, by maintaining detailed logs of all transactions, Luckypays can comply with regulatory requirements, such as AML (Anti-Money Laundering) standards, and provide transparency for audits.
One notable case involved detecting a bot-assisted betting scheme that attempted to exploit game algorithms, which was thwarted within hours thanks to continuous monitoring. This exemplifies how real-time transaction analysis is indispensable for secure online gambling environments.
Implementing 256-bit SSL Encryption for Confidential Data Exchange
Secure data transmission is fundamental to protecting sensitive player information, including personal details, banking data, and transaction history. Luckypays Casino utilizes 256-bit SSL (Secure Sockets Layer) encryption, the industry standard for safeguarding online communications, ensuring that data exchanged between players and servers remains confidential and tamper-proof.
This encryption level employs complex algorithms that render intercepted data unreadable to malicious actors. For example, when a player deposits funds or updates account information, the entire data exchange is encrypted, preventing man-in-the-middle attacks and eavesdropping.
According to cybersecurity reports, 98% of top-tier online casinos adopt 256-bit SSL encryption, reflecting its critical role in compliance with data protection regulations like GDPR and PCI DSS. Implementing these standards not only protects players but also enhances trust, which is essential in a competitive industry.
To illustrate, a breach involving unencrypted data in a similar platform resulted in a $2 million fine and loss of customer confidence. Conversely, Luckypays’ commitment to SSL encryption has maintained its reputation for security and integrity.
AI-Driven User Behavior Analysis to Anticipate and Block Cheating Patterns
Artificial Intelligence (AI) has revolutionized security protocols in online gambling by enabling predictive analysis of user behavior. Luckypays employs AI-powered systems that scrutinize thousands of data points—including betting patterns, session durations, and response times—to identify anomalies indicative of cheating or collusion.
For example, if an account exhibits a 60% win rate over a series of high RTP games like Starburst (96.09%), significantly above the industry average of 96%, the system flags this for further review. The AI models are trained on historical data, allowing them to detect subtle signs of bot activity or collusion that might escape manual oversight.
Studies show that AI detection systems can identify up to 85% of fraudulent behaviors in real-time, providing a crucial layer of security. Luckypays’ AI monitors user activity continuously, adapting to new tactics used by cheaters and ensuring fair play.
In practice, this approach has led to the suspension of accounts involved in multi-accounting and collusion within 24 hours, safeguarding the integrity of the gaming environment and ensuring compliance with licensing authorities like the UKGC.
Conducting Frequent Security Audits to Maintain Compliance and Update Protocols
Regular security audits are essential for identifying vulnerabilities and ensuring compliance with evolving industry standards. Luckypays conducts comprehensive audits at least quarterly, involving third-party cybersecurity firms that assess system architecture, software, and operational procedures.
These audits examine aspects like access controls, data encryption, and user authentication mechanisms, ensuring they meet standards set by bodies such as the ISO/IEC 27001 framework. Findings from recent audits revealed that updating outdated software components reduced potential attack vectors by 40%, enhancing overall security posture.
Furthermore, audits are crucial for maintaining licensing compliance; for example, the UK Gambling Commission mandates annual audits to verify adherence to anti-fraud and data protection regulations. Implementing recommended improvements within a 30-day window ensures that security measures stay current against emerging threats.
In one case, an audit uncovered a vulnerability in the platform’s password reset process, which was promptly patched, preventing potential exploitation. This proactive stance keeps Luckypays ahead of cybercriminals and reassures players of their safety.

Verifying Licensed Software and Maintaining a Secure Supply Chain
The integrity of game software is a critical component of online security. Luckypays exclusively partners with licensed and reputable providers, such as NetEnt and Microgaming, known for their rigorous security protocols and adherence to industry standards.
To prevent vulnerabilities, the platform verifies that all third-party software is up-to-date, with patches applied within 48 hours of release. Regular audits of the supply chain ensure that no unlicensed or compromised software is integrated into the platform.
For example, in 2022, a major casino was fined $5 million for using unlicensed software that contained exploitable vulnerabilities. In contrast, Luckypays’ strict licensing and update procedures prevent such issues, maintaining a secure environment for players.
Furthermore, employing digital signatures and cryptographic verification ensures that software updates are authentic and tamper-proof, reducing the risk of malware infiltration.
Adopting Privacy-by-Design Principles to Embed Security at Every System Level
The privacy-by-design approach advocates integrating security measures into every stage of system development. Luckypays adopts this philosophy by embedding encryption, access controls, and regular testing into its infrastructure from the ground up.
For instance, each new feature undergoes security assessments before deployment, ensuring potential vulnerabilities are addressed early. This proactive integration reduces the likelihood of breaches; recent implementations of multi-layer encryption, including end-to-end encryption for chat features, have resulted in zero reported data leaks in the past 12 months.
By emphasizing secure coding practices and continuous monitoring, Luckypays minimizes attack surfaces and complies with GDPR and other data protection laws. This comprehensive approach not only safeguards player data but also fosters a culture of security awareness across the organization.
Implementing a Robust Incident Response Plan for Immediate Breach Mitigation
Despite preventative efforts, preparedness for security incidents remains essential. Luckypays maintains a detailed incident response plan that outlines immediate actions to contain, assess, and remediate breaches within 24 hours.
The plan includes steps such as isolating affected systems, notifying stakeholders, and conducting forensic analyses to determine breach scope. Recent incidents involving attempted DDoS attacks were mitigated swiftly, with service restored within 4 hours and no loss of player funds or data.
Regular training ensures that staff can recognize signs of security breaches and respond effectively. Additionally, the casino reports security metrics monthly, aiming for a 100% response rate to threats.
This proactive stance underscores Luckypays’ commitment to maintaining a safe gambling environment and protecting player trust, reinforcing its reputation as a secure online casino platform.
